General Information
Title: Despair
First Line: Out of the deeps of long distress
Composer: Barnabas McKyes
Lyricist: Isaac Watts
Number of voices: 4vv Voicing: SATB
Genre: Sacred Meter: 86. 86 (C.M.)
Language: English
Instruments: A cappella
First published: 1798 in Social Harmony, p. 27
Description: Words by Isaac Watts, 1717, paraphrase of Psalm 130, Part 1, with eight stanzas.
